1. The Guenther House

Location: 205 E Guenther St, San Antonio, TX 78204
Price Range: $$-$$$

Tucked away in the heart of San Antonio’s charming King William Historic District, The Guenther House is a delightful spot that feels like stepping back in time. This historic gem is housed in a beautifully restored 19th-century mansion, offering a cozy and inviting atmosphere that’s perfect for a leisurely breakfast or brunch.

The Guenther House is known for its Southern-style comfort food, with a menu that highlights classic dishes made with love. Their specialty? The fluffy, homemade biscuits and pancakes that have become a local favorite. Pair them with their signature sausage gravy or a generous helping of syrup, and you’re in for a real treat.

Whether you’re a history buff or just someone who appreciates a good meal in a beautiful setting, The Guenther House offers an experience that’s both relaxing and memorable. It’s the kind of place where you can slow down, enjoy the moment, and savor every bite.

2. Mi Tierra Café y Panadería

Location: 218 Produce Row, San Antonio, TX 78207
Price Range: $$

Stepping into Mi Tierra Café y Panadería in San Antonio feels like walking into a vibrant fiesta that’s happening all day, every day. This iconic restaurant has been a local favorite since 1941, and it’s easy to see why. With its colorful decorations, lively atmosphere, and warm hospitality, Mi Tierra is more than just a place to eat—it’s an experience.

Mi Tierra is famous for its traditional Mexican dishes, served with a side of genuine warmth and hospitality. Their specialty? The Breakfast Tacos and the hearty, flavorful Chilaquiles that locals rave about. And don’t even think about leaving without trying something sweet from their in-house bakery, which is filled with an array of delicious pastries and pan dulce.

Whether you’re a San Antonio native or just passing through, Mi Tierra Café y Panadería is a must-visit. It’s the perfect spot to kick off your day with a delicious meal and soak in the lively, festive spirit of this beloved city.

3.  Liberty Bar

Location: 1111 S Alamo St, San Antonio, TX 78210
Price Range: $$-$$$

Liberty Bar in San Antonio is one of those places that feels like a well-kept secret, even though it’s a beloved local favorite. Housed in a quirky, pink-hued historic building that leans slightly to one side, Liberty Bar has character in spades. It’s a spot where history and charm blend seamlessly, offering a dining experience that’s as unique as the building itself.

Liberty Bar is known for its inventive take on classic dishes, with a menu that offers a little something for everyone. Their specialty? The rich and flavorful chilaquiles and their famous sticky buns, which are the perfect balance of sweet and indulgent. Whether you’re in the mood for a hearty breakfast or a more adventurous dish, Liberty Bar has you covered.

As you step inside, you’re greeted by a warm and inviting interior that’s both rustic and eclectic. The wooden beams, mismatched furniture, and vintage decor create a cozy atmosphere that feels both lived-in and loved. It’s the kind of place where you can easily settle in for a leisurely meal, surrounded by the charming quirks that make this spot so special.

7. Schilo’s

Location: 424 E Commerce St, San Antonio, TX 78205
Price Range: $$

Schilo’s in San Antonio is a true gem that’s been serving up delicious comfort food for over a century. This historic deli is one of the city’s oldest restaurants, and it’s easy to see why it’s stood the test of time. With its old-world charm and hearty German-American dishes, Schilo’s offers a dining experience that’s both nostalgic and satisfying.

When it comes to the menu, Schilo’s is famous for its hearty, traditional fare. Their specialty? The homemade split pea soup and the classic Reuben sandwich, both of which have been local favorites for generations. And if you’re in the mood for breakfast, their fluffy German pancakes and savory sausage are a perfect way to start the day.

12. Bedoy’s Bakery

Location: 1320 W Commerce St, San Antonio, TX 78207
Price Range: $

Bedoy’s Bakery in San Antonio is a beloved local treasure that’s been satisfying sweet cravings for decades. Known for its authentic Mexican pastries and warm, friendly atmosphere, this family-owned bakery has become a go-to spot for anyone looking to start their day with a delicious treat. Whether you’re picking up a box of goodies for the office or just grabbing a quick breakfast, Bedoy’s never disappoints.

Bedoy’s Bakery is famous for its Pan Dulce, a traditional Mexican sweet bread that comes in all sorts of shapes, sizes, and flavors. Their conchas, with their soft, fluffy interior and crunchy, sugary topping, are a particular favorite. But the menu doesn’t stop there—you’ll also find savory options like breakfast tacos, making it a perfect spot to grab a bite on the go.

As you step inside, you’re greeted by the delightful aroma of fresh-baked bread and pastries. The interior is simple and cozy, with display cases filled to the brim with colorful conchas, empanadas, and other traditional Mexican delights. If you’re in the mood for a taste of tradition served with a side of friendly service, Bedoy’s Bakery is the place to be. It’s a spot where you can enjoy the simple pleasure of a well-made pastry in a setting that’s as welcoming as it is delicious.
